Documentary filmmaker Joanna Lipper sat down with a dozen children from America, Ireland and England and let them interpret the world in this look at the internal life of children, sharing their dreams, wishes and hopes. An American boy talks about his Hungarian grandmother, a survivor of the Holocaust; two African-American girls speak of their imaginative fantasies and a boy who lives in a New York shelter discusses his drawings. Interviews are interwoven with fantasy sequences based on the children's play, highlighting the realness and importance of the children's mental life. Lipper says she not only wanted to record these children's dreams and fantasies, but also examine how different lifestyles and beliefs affected children's imaginations.
